Time is passing swiftly. We are beginning to prepare for the holiday season. The stores are already decorating for Christmas and I saw my first Christmas commercial last night on television. A New Year is rapidly approaching.

As I am writing this, we are getting reports of our world in distress with more soul wrenching events daily. What lies before us only our heavenly Father knows. God knows what He wants to transpire in our world today. Every living soul is posed with the decision of whether to heed the leading of God or to choose an alternative. Many are struggling to define God’s purpose and will for today while others are literally giving their life’s blood in the name of Jesus. All over the world every person has that choice and God’s Spirit is striving with us all. But, it shall not always be for the Bible says, “...My spirit shall not always strive with man...” Genesis 6:3.

God is dealing with all of us as individuals, urging us to follow His path. For some, God will make His presence known in a very strong and profound manner. For others it may be less conspicuous. However, God will expose the world to His influence and every person will make the choice to follow or not. Thereby, we choose the course of our lives and the inevitable end of that choice.

The leaders of governments will make decisions today that will bring them and their system of government more inline with the justice and rule of God’s law or their decisions will put them in opposition to God. This is “anti-Christ” and the leaders of nations are making that choice today. Those choices will put them on an inevitable collision with the judgment of God. Many have already made their choice and are suffering the pains of Divine judgment.

Our heavenly Father knows the way that we should take. Jeremiah 29:11, “For I know the thoughts that I think toward you, saith the LORD, thoughts of peace, and not of evil, to give you an expected end.” We must walk close to Him so He may convey His direction to us. He will direct our steps if we will hear and obey His voice. John 10:27, “My sheep hear my voice, and I know them, and they follow me:” Our relationship must be such that we will hear and willingly consent to His guidance. He will lead us! He will be all that we need Him to be! He will never leave nor forsake His Children! Glory to the name of Jesus our Savior! Amen!!!

Individuals and nations will be defined by the choices they make today! The Bible describes the end result of those choices in Romans 6:20, “For when ye were the servants of sin, ye were free from righteousness. 21What fruit had ye then in those things whereof ye are now ashamed? for the end of those things is death. 22But now being made free from sin, and become servants to God, ye have your fruit unto holiness, and the end everlasting life. 23For the wages of sin is death; but the gift of God is eternal life through Jesus Christ our Lord.” From the Word of God, you can determine what is ahead for you!
